@Beta @ThreadSafe @MetaInfServices public final class YangParserFactoryImpl extends Object implements org.opendaylight.yangtools.yang.model.parser.api.YangParserFactory
YangParserFactory implementation.| Constructor and Description |
|---|
YangParserFactoryImpl()
Construct a new
YangParserFactory backed by DefaultReactors.defaultReactor(). |
YangParserFactoryImpl(@NonNull org.opendaylight.yangtools.yang.parser.stmt.reactor.CrossSourceStatementReactor reactor)
Construct a new
YangParserFactory backed by specified reactor. |
| Modifier and Type | Method and Description |
|---|---|
org.opendaylight.yangtools.yang.model.parser.api.YangParser |
createParser(org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ode parserMode) |
Collection<org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ode> |
supportedParserModes() |
public YangParserFactoryImpl()
YangParserFactory backed by DefaultReactors.defaultReactor().public YangParserFactoryImpl(@NonNull org.opendaylight.yangtools.yang.parser.stmt.reactor.CrossSourceStatementReactor reactor)
YangParserFactory backed by specified reactor.reactor - Backing reactorpublic Collection<org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ode> supportedParserModes()
supportedParserModes in interface org.opendaylight.yangtools.yang.model.parser.api.YangParserFactorypublic org.opendaylight.yangtools.yang.model.parser.api.YangParser createParser(org.opendaylight.yangtools.yang.model.repo.api.StatementParserMode parserMode)
createParser in interface org.opendaylight.yangtools.yang.model.parser.api.YangParserFactoryCopyright © 2019 OpenDaylight. All rights reserved.